I adore embossing on black and the Suite Sayings stamp set was the perfect addition to this modern, clean card. I used one of the tags from the Gift Card Envelope and Trims Thinlits. I think it is so HOT. I used dimensions to make that pop out.

This was a super simple card to make and yet I really love the look and the finished card. The colours are just gorgeous together. To layer the angles I kept it really simple and cut all three colours in the same measurements (14.4 x 10cm) And then cut the Basic Grey and Daffodil Delight at the angles that I wanted and layered them - the smoky slate I didn't cut at all.
